I watched some videos yest and some say it's an elaborated scheme to cheat from the start, some say his business got into trouble, and a few say that was just a publicity stunt (he will reappear again).

Anyway the advice stays the same - beware of those fly-by-night dealers who appear to "make it" or carry lots of RM/gold Nautilus/Royal Oak/Rolex rainbow inventory. This industry is an unregulated one and customers bear most of the risks such as dealers running away with consigned watches, fake watches (Horology House), frankenstein watches, undeclared polished watches, wrong/fake papers, etc etc. Be careful when you deal with these dealers.
